Top 10 VR Games on Steam, May 2020

Greetings VR Fam!

We've scoured the Steam public sales figures for May to bring you the top selling VR games this month. The #1 spot is no surprise, but I am surprised at how long #2 has held out. Let's take a look.

Space Pirate Trainer #10

  • Steam Rating: Overwhelmingly Positive (2,206 reviews)
  • Multiplayer: Single-Player Only
  • Supported Controls: Motion Controllers
  • Play Area: Seated / Standing / Room-Scale
  • Supported Devices: Index / Vive / Rift / WMR

“Remember those awesome classic arcade cabinets? Imagine if those were immersive... Space Pirate Trainer puts you in one of those; fighting off relentless waves of droids with all the weapons and gadgets you would ever need as a space pirate. You better dodge some of those incoming lasers though, since just using your shields won't get you in the top rankings. Pick up your blasters, put on your sneakers, and dance your way into the Space Pirate Trainer hall of fame.”

Gorn #9

  • Steam Rating: Overwhelmingly Positive (5,058 reviews)
  • Multiplayer: Single-Player Only
  • Supported Controls: Motion Controllers
  • Play Area: Room-Scale
  • Supported Devices: Index / Vive / Rift / WMR

“GORN is a ludicrously violent VR gladiator simulator, made by Free Lives, the developers of Broforce and Genital Jousting. Featuring a unique, fully physics driven combat engine, GORN combatants will be able to creatively execute their most violent gladiatorial fantasies in virtual reality. Savagely strike down an infinite supply of poorly-animated opponents with all manner of weapons – from swords, maces, and bows to nunchuks, throwing knives, massive two-handed warhammers or even your blood-soaked bare hands. The only limits to the carnage are your imagination and decency, in the most brutal and savage VR face-smashing game ever produced by man.”

Blade and Sorcery #8

  • Steam Rating: Overwhelmingly Positive (7,805 reviews)
  • Multiplayer: Single-Player Only
  • Supported Controls: Motion Controllers
  • Play Area: Standing / Room-Scale
  • Supported Devices: Index / Vive / Rift / WMR

“The era of the VR weightless, wiggle-sword combat is over. Blade & Sorcery is a medieval fantasy sandbox like no other, focusing on melee, ranged and magic combat that fully utilizes a unique and realistic physics driven interaction and combat system.”

Jet Island #7

  • Steam Rating: Overwhelmingly Positive (808 reviews)
  • Multiplayer: Single-Player / Online Co-op / Online PvP
  • Supported Controls: Motion Controllers
  • Play Area: Seated / Standing / Room-Scale
  • Supported Devices: Index / Vive / Rift / WMR

“Jet Island is massive open world and you have an arsenal of tools that will allow you to travel through this world at extreme speeds! When standing on your hoverboard, the ground below you becomes frictionless. Perfect for sliding up and down the mountainous terrain. To control the direction of your movement and gain even more speed, you have two wrist mounted jet thrusters. You also have grappling hooks to swing from tall structures and climb up the side of giant monsters. The combination of these tools provide a freedom of movement unlike any other. There are no limits to what you can do. It's the closest feeling to learning how to fly.”

Space Engine #6

  • Steam Rating: Overwhelmingly Positive (2,757 reviews)
  • Multiplayer: Single-Player Only
  • Supported Controls: Motion Controllers / Gamepad / Mouse
  • Play Area: Seated / Standing / Room-Scale
  • Supported Devices: Index / Vive / Rift / WMR

“SpaceEngine is a 1:1 scale science-based Universe simulator, featuring billions upon billions of galaxies, nebulae, stars, and planets, all shown at their full real-world scale. Explore Earth and our neighboring worlds in the Solar System, orbit a black hole in a galaxy billions of light-years away, or visit anything in between seamlessly, with no transitions.”

IronWolf VR #4

  • Steam Rating: Overwhelmingly Positive (539 reviews)
  • Multiplayer: Single-Player / Splitscreen Co-op / Splitscreen PvP / Online
  • Supported Controls: Motion Controllers
  • Play Area: Standing / Room-Scale
  • Supported Devices: Index / Vive / Rift / WMR

“IronWolf VR is a roomscale submarine game playable either as singleplayer or online co-op. Unleash torpedoes on enemy ships, shoot down fighters and bombers using anti-aircraft guns, and attempt to survive depth charges dropped by deadly destroyers. Built from the ground up for VR, each part of the submarine has been crafted for the best possible VR experience.”

Keep Talking and Nobody Explodes #2

  • Steam Rating: Overwhelmingly Positive (6,175 reviews)
  • Multiplayer: Splitscreen Co-op / Splitscreen PvP
  • Supported Controls: Motion Controllers / Gamepad
  • Play Area: Seated / Standing
  • Supported Devices: Index / Vive / Rift / WMR

“You’re alone in a room with a bomb. Your friends, the “Experts”, have the manual needed to defuse it. But there’s a catch: the Experts can’t see the bomb, so everyone will need to talk it out – fast!”

Half-Life Alyx #1

  • Steam Rating: Overwhelmingly Positive (24,080 reviews)
  • Multiplayer: Single-Player Only
  • Supported Controls: Motion Controllers Required
  • Play Area: Seated / Standing / Room-Scale
  • Supported Devices: Index / Vive / Rift / WMR

“Half-Life: Alyx is Valve’s VR return to the Half-Life series. It’s the story of an impossible fight against a vicious alien race known as the Combine, set between the events of Half-Life and Half-Life 2.”
